#16018D Hex Color Code

#16018D

The Hexadecimal Color #16018D is a contrast shade of Dark Blue. #16018D RGB value is rgb(22, 1, 141). RGB Color Model of #16018D consists of 8% red, 0% green and 55% blue. HSL color Mode of #16018D has 249°(degrees) Hue, 99% Saturation and 28% Lightness. #16018D color has an wavelength of 463.22222n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#16018D is #333399.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#16018D is #108. The Closest Color to #16018D is #00008B. Official Name of #16018D Hex Code is Ultramarine.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#16018D is 84 Cyan 99 Magenta 0 Yellow 45 Black and #16018D CMY is 84, 99,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#16018D is hsl(249,99,28,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(249, 99, 55).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#16018D is 5.15, 2.11, 25.33.
Hex8 Value of #16018D is #16018DFF. Decimal Value of #16018D is 1442189 and Octal Value of #16018D is 5400615. Binary Value of #16018D is 10110, 1, 10001101 and Android of #16018D is 4279632269 / 0xff16018d.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#16018D is 0.158, 0.065, 0.065 and YIQ Color Space of #16018D is 23.239, -32.4681, 48.0095.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#16018D is 0.57, 0.11, 24.95.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#16018D is 16.05, 51.04, -67.74.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#16018D is 16.05, -3.17, -62.61.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#16018D is 16.05, 84.82, 307.0. Hunter Lab variable of #16018D is 14.53, 37.87, -93.22.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#16018D

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
